WINEMAKER

Winery Carsten Saalwächter

Carsten Saalwächter stands for a calm, thoughtful approach to German wine, rooted in precision and restraint rather than expressionism. His work is shaped by a deep respect for vineyards and a clear belief that balance and longevity come from patience, not intervention.

Farming is carried out with great care, focusing on healthy soils and low yields, while cellar work remains deliberately minimal. Time plays a central role in his wines: long élevage, gentle handling, and no rush to release. His rise didn’t happen through hype, but through consistency.

For me, Saalwächter is THE reference when it comes to Chardonnay and Silvaner in Germany: wines with depth, tension, and an effortless sense of calm that very few manage to achieve. What makes them so addictive is the way they combine lees-driven texture with a saline, mineral line — they feel composed, never pushed.

His élevage is famously patient, often leaning on larger oak formats and extended time on lees to build structure without losing clarity.

The resulting wines are clear, structured, and quietly complex, driven by saltyness and power. Subtle, confident, and built to last — His wines will turn heads that`s for sure!
